Transaction 05c578bfde60f512aebf4e6ca532dec27953c1e970ef74cbed24ed2ece7ae23c

1 Input
2 Outputs
  • 05c578bfde60f512aebf4e6ca532dec27953c1e970ef74cbed24ed2ece7ae23c:0
  • value  10529175
    address  36gD3BUdE2SHLg7gEmb7jv6tJ5Lg1rHtbA
  • 05c578bfde60f512aebf4e6ca532dec27953c1e970ef74cbed24ed2ece7ae23c:1
  • value  1460731
    address  1NpZEeGKaNU4EUEhV6wME2aqeJbjgnFrKL